Overview of this book

Procreate is robust, industry-grade painting software that is extremely versatile yet an affordable alternative to subscription-based applications. If you're new to Procreate, Get Set Procreate 5 will help you get up to speed with creating professional illustrations in no time. Complete with step-by-step instructions, detailed explanations, and practical application guidelines, this easy-to-follow guide will cover the ins and outs of Procreate 5.2 and show you how to use each feature effectively. You'll learn how to draw using assistive tools, apply effects, create animations, and develop amazing artwork by implementing the skills learned throughout the book. Once you've got to grips with the new features of Procreate 5 for creating beautiful illustrations, animations, and graphics, you'll be able to explore the tools at your disposal and even create your own brushes, shortcuts, and menus to work efficiently. By the end of this Procreate book, you'll be able to navigate the application confidently and take your artwork to a new level.

Understanding 3D models

Before getting into the 3D painting features of Procreate, this section will help you form an understanding of how painting on 3D models is made possible. For that, we need to look at painted 3D models as a composite of two parts: the model and the UV map. The presence of a UV map allows you to paint on a 3D model, which would otherwise not be possible. In the following subsection, we will discuss UV maps.

UV maps

3D painting in Procreate requires your 3D model to have an associated UV map. Think of a UV map as a two-dimensional skin that covers all the surfaces of your model like wrapping paper. The following diagram explains how a 2D UV map sits on a 3D model:

Figure 15.4 : A 3D model versus an unwrapped UV map
